The Engineering Tower of University of California, Irvine, completed in 1970. Henry L. Wright FAIA (1904–1999) was an American architect in practice in Los Angeles from 1941 to 1990. From 1962 to 1963 he was president of the American Institute of Architects.

William J. Gage (March 8, 1891 – September 28, 1965) was an American architect. He designed many buildings in Los Angeles County, California , including Beverly Hills and Bel Air . [ 1 ]

Craig Ellwood (born Jon Nelson Burke; April 22, 1922 – May 30, 1992) was an American architect whose career spanned the early 1950s through the mid-1970s in Los Angeles. Although untrained as an architect, he fashioned an influential persona and career through a talent for good design, self-promotion, and ambition.
Nabih Youssef, S.E., F.A.S.C.E (May 29, 1944 – July 12, 2024) [1] was an American structural engineer, most recognized for his work in seismic engineering. [2] Youssef is recognized for translating academic structural engineering concepts into practical applications, most notably through the base isolation technique employed in the Los Angeles City Hall renovations.
